Track This Job
Add this job to your tracking list to:
- Monitor application status and updates
- Change status (Applied, Interview, Offer, etc.)
- Add personal notes and comments
- Set reminders for follow-ups
- Track your entire application journey
Save This Job
Add this job to your saved collection to:
- Access easily from your saved jobs dashboard
- Review job details later without searching again
- Compare with other saved opportunities
- Keep a collection of interesting positions
- Receive notifications about saved jobs before they expire
AI-Powered Job Summary
Get a concise overview of key job requirements, responsibilities, and qualifications in seconds.
Pro Tip: Use this feature to quickly decide if a job matches your skills before reading the full description.
Help us master the challenge of creating and developing tailor-made 3D modeling software for geometric modeling of individually manufactured custom-made earmolds and in-the-ear hearing aid shells. Help further automation of the software by fostering machine-learning on huge datasets. Be part of our developer-driven culture which fosters your creativity and programming skills in all aspects of the software development life-cycle.
More About Your Role
- Analysis, design and implementation of a 3D modeling application and services
- Implementation in C# / .NET, testing and documentation of the application and services
- Maintenance of native algorithms in C++, as well as interop between managed and native parts
- Monitor and further develop a modern software development process (based on Git/GitHub, TeamCity, NuGet, Jira/Azure DevOps)
- Take on functional ownership and keep close collaboration with other software engineers in an agile setup
- Evolve agile development
- Close collaboration with external partners and globally within Sonova
- Bachelor or Master's degree in computer science, software engineering or equivalent
- Experienced in Windows C#/.NET desktop application development
- Proven knowledge of software design and development principles like SOLID
- Knowledge of 3D computer graphics and geometric modeling
- Solution-oriented positive thinker and team player
- Fluent in English; German is a plus
- Knowledge of interactive geometry manipulation is a plus
- Knowhow in C++ and OpenGL 3D rendering is a plus
- Knowledge of managed–native interoperability is a plus
- Knowledge of AI and machine learning is a plus (e.g. ONNX machine learning models)
We can offer you a new challenge, with interesting tasks and much more – including an open corporate culture, flat hierarchies, support for further training and development, opportunities to grow and take on further responsibility, an excellent range of foods, sports and cultural facilities, attractive employment conditions, and flexible working time models in various roles. Employment level 80-100%.
Magdalena Suszek, Talent Acquisition Partner, is looking forward to receiving your application (cover letter, CV, references and certificates) via our online job application platform.
For this vacancy only direct applications will be considered.
Sonova is an equal opportunity employer.
We team up. We grow talent. We collaborate with people of diverse backgrounds to win with the best team in the market place. We guarantee every person equal treatment in regard to employment and opportunity for employment, regardless of a candidate’s ethnic or national origin, religion, sexual orientation or marital status, gender, genetic identity, age, disability or any other legally protected status.
Key Skills
Ranked by relevanceReady to apply?
Join Sonova Group and take your career to the next level!
Application takes less than 5 minutes

